How can we fix our Sanyo?

Our tv was blown by a storm we had the other night. The socket it was plugged into was supposed to be surge protected, but obviously not. The socket works fine now, but the tv is still broke. It has current running through it, but it wont come on at all. It is a 21" Sanyo, I'm not sure of the model. The fuse does'nt look blown, but is it possible that that's whats wrong? Can it be fixed?

there is a 4amp/125volt fuse right near the end of the power cord(internal).its very easy to open tv and change.

check the internal fuses, you can make a simple circuit tester from the parts of a torch. the fuse is either ok or blown. good luck.
